Mashi: The Unfulfilled Baseball Dreams of Masanori Murakami, the First Japanese Major Leaguer, written by Robert K. Fitts

  • Introduction to Masanori Murakami: The first Japanese player to join Major League Baseball (MLB) and his aspirations to fulfill his dreams in a foreign land.
  • Early Life: Explore Masanori's childhood in Japan, his passion for baseball, and the cultural environment that shaped him.
  • Path to MLB: Detailed account of how Murakami transitioned from Japanese baseball to the American league, highlighting the challenges he faced.
  • 1964 MLB Season: A glimpse into his rookie year with the San Francisco Giants, including key moments that define his experience.
  • Struggles with Identity: The cultural clash Murakami experienced while trying to navigate a career in a sport dominated by American players.
  • Impact on Japanese Baseball: Murakami's significance in paving the way for future Japanese athletes in MLB and his enduring legacy.
  • Personal Journey: Insights into his personal life, including the emotional and social hurdles he encountered during his journey.
  • Post-MLB Life: What happened to Masanori Murakami after his time in Major League Baseball, including his return to Japan and reflections on his career.
  • Impact and Legacy: Discussion of how Murakami's story inspired a generation of Japanese baseball players and reshaped perceptions within the sport.
